GTA 6: Rockstar Games speaks out after the leak case


Since Sunday September 18, it must be admitted that the world of the video game industry has been quite shaken because of the huge leak suffered by the major studio, Rockstar Games. When no one expected it, a hacker decided to share on GTAForums several videos of the long-awaited Grand Theft Auto 6, creating the anger of players, but also the satisfaction of some.

It is on this Monday, September 19 that Rockstar Games developers have decided to speak up about this unfortunate event. One thing is certain, GTA 6 is still well and truly planned, so don’t worry about that.

Rockstar Games Speaks After Massive GTA 6 Leak Released

It is indeed on the various social networks and in particular on Twitter that the starred firm has just shared a press release. Although it is quite short, it nevertheless expresses the dissatisfaction of the developers, and this can largely be understood.

We recently experienced a network breach in which an unauthorized third party illegally gained access to our systems and downloaded confidential information, including development footage for the upcoming Grand Theft Auto. At this time, we do not anticipate any disruption to our live game services or any long-term effect on the development of our ongoing projects. We are extremely disappointed that details about our upcoming game have been shared with you in this way. Our work on the next Grand Theft Auto game will continue as planned, and we remain as committed to providing you, our players, with an experience that truly exceeds your expectations. We’ll let you know soon and, of course, we’ll show you this next game as soon as it’s ready. We would like to thank everyone for their continued support in this situation.

The Rockstar Games Team

Through this press release, several things are confirmed. First of all, it is therefore indeed images of the next game from Rockstar Games, namely, GTA 6and this therefore affirms several rumors that we have been able to read lately (in particular on these famous characters).

Moreover, despite this cataclysm, the developers have decided, at least for the moment, to continue the development of the game, and ensure that they will present it to players when it is ready. This therefore confirms that the images we saw were only “prototypes”, as several tweets claimed and as we were able to tell you just a few hours ago.
